I Enjoy the Use of Symbolism

It is great! I think it is work studying all sorts of symbols. Symbols are used for many things that people do think about. Some people with tattoos use symbols as identifying who they are or what they been threw. Many people today and threw out history have also used symbols to identify themselves to say "Hey I am here!" or "I am one of you". Symbols not only identify. Symbols have been seen as form of a code to keep secrets away from others. There are some symbols that are the other way around! Some symbols are known to all to keep people safe, like the skull and cross bones symbol to mark poison on bottles. What I think is cool that is not only though, are symbols used for practical use but religious use to.

Symbols are found all over in many religions and even be seen by some as a "source of power". Which I think is strange in real life but interesting on how these markings or lines or whatever the symbol is. Came to be worshiped by many. If you think about it, it is like saying that these words. The words you are reading right now. Have magical or divine powers that can change life itself! That is how some people or some religions see symbols. Strange right?

So symbols have practical uses and "magical" uses, but they also serve a role in many loved books, movies, and ... well anything entertainment wise. There are many popular things that use symbols are use to foreshadow. Or used to help the readers be connected with the book, like Harry Potter and it's famous "Griffindor". Writers, as well as movie makers, make groups that hold certain personality traits. Traits that many can relate to and see themselves being part of this grouping. Which helps draw in the reader or viewer. Some books even have iconic symbols to show what a character is like. So symbols can help make a world seem more real to a reader or viewer.

Also symbols can be seen to help advertisements to. From the story Aladdin, Jafar's staff is a snake headed staff that he uses to cast spells on people. Could you picture Jafar, with a turtle staff or a pink unicorn one? No, because the snake is used here as a symbol of evil or villain like, which helps define what type of character Jarfar is. As of recent, a show called Once Upon A Time is a show where we see many classic characters. Such as Snow White, Sleepy Beauty, Wicked Witch, Peter Pan, Red Ridding Hood, and more all come together in this show. When word got out that new characters where coming to the show in a new season. A picture of a snake head staff was released by the show creators and so everyone knew that the new charters where from Aladdin.

So from history, to secret codes, to religion, and many more places. Symbols are used in a number of ways and for a number of reasons. So when you see one you may not know what they are stand for or if is a reason they are around. However, you can't say they are not used often or have no reason to be studied because they are all around us. Sometimes we just don't acknowledge they are there is all because we are so use to them already.
